Unpacking the 2000 Dodge Ram Wiring Diagram

A 2000 Dodge Ram Wiring Diagram is essentially a map of your truck's electrical system. It visually represents how all the wires, components, and circuits are connected. Think of it like a blueprint for the electricity flowing through your vehicle. Without this diagram, identifying the source of a problem, such as a flickering light or a non-functioning accessory, would be like trying to navigate a complex city without a map. Understanding the 2000 Dodge Ram Wiring Diagram is fundamentally important for effective and safe electrical repairs.

These diagrams are typically broken down into various systems within the truck. You'll find sections dedicated to different areas, which can include:

  • Engine Control Module (ECM) and related sensors
  • Lighting systems (headlights, taillights, interior lights)
  • Power accessories (windows, locks, mirrors)
  • Audio and infotainment systems
  • Braking and ABS systems

Each section will show the specific wires, connectors, fuses, relays, and the components they power. This detailed breakdown allows for pinpoint accuracy when diagnosing issues. For example, if your power windows aren't working, you can consult the power accessory section of the 2000 Dodge Ram Wiring Diagram to trace the power source, check fuses and relays, and identify potential wire breaks.

Using a 2000 Dodge Ram Wiring Diagram involves a systematic approach. First, identify the specific system or component you are having trouble with. Then, locate the corresponding section in the diagram. Follow the lines representing wires to see where power originates, what components are in line, and where grounding points are.
